Things are moving much faster now, MSP AFIS has no backlog currently, so it's working as fast as PD's can get the paperwork done and as fast as the FRB can print them...
 
I just got my first time LTC about 3 months ago. I have a green carc so they did an ICE check first. After that was good and I filled the application out, I had my Class A with no Restrictions in about 2.5 weeks. Couldn't believe how fast it was. I'm in Pelham, MA

Me and my buddy just picked up our LTC A's in Worcester, unrestricted.

04/XX/13 - called to make appointment.
08/29/13 - Appointment, submitted paperwork, fingerprinted
11/29/13 - Approved
12/05/13 - Issued
12/13/12 - LTC A Unrestricted in hand!

Applied 10/18/13

Called FRB on 12/18/12 and was told I was approved and just waiting for printing of card then will be mailed to PD for activation

12/18/13 checks cashed.

My wife was told on 12/18/13 that her card was already mailed to PD. she called PD and they told her it's waiting for activation from LO. Should have it in a week. Northbridge,Ma.

Lakeville, Applied for new LTC A

11/16/13 had interview, fingerprints
12/9/13 check cleared
12/19/13 called status line just for the heck of it because I've seen a few posts recently here with people getting their LTC back pretty quick. Nice lady said it was activated on 12/16/13 and it's waiting to be printed and sent to the local PD. She said I should have it by next week! I'll report back when it's in. Hopefully she is accurate.
